Silver Creek development needs different housing

It is appalling that the Common Council approved a zoning change to allow Mr. May to build a very inappropriate development in the Silver Creek area. Apparently, the members who approved this are only interested in the money.

They have no consideration for the surrounding families who will probably encounter lower property values along with lower quality of life, all for the benefit of Mr. May.

I attempted to talk with Mr. May concerning an alternate development plan. We have heard from real estate agents that there is a need for quality one-level homes. I wanted to encourage him to build an appropriate number of quality one-level homes.

That could result in a nice neighborhood and simplify some of the horrible traffic issues he will probably have with his plan. He refuses to talk with me.

Where do you stand with this issue, Mr. Miller?

Jean Hickey

Oneonta
